Bismihi Ta'aalaa 4th Zul-Qa'dah 1426 - 5th December 2005 Since the discharge is not continuous she will not be classified as a Ma'zoor, thus she cannot take advantage of the concessions given to a Ma'zoor.
The ruling for a woman who discharges frequently (to such an extent that it goes unnoticed at times) is:-
(1) Her Salaat will be valid as long as she is not certain that discharge came out in Salaat. (Mere doubt of discharge flowing during Salaat will not render her Salaat invalid.)
(2) Such a woman should insert a tampon, pad etc. This will help to absorb the discharge. Until the discharge does not show on the area of the pad which is beyond the inner part of the vagina, wudhu will not break.
(Ahsan-ul-Fatawaa, Page 80, Part 1)
